Mechatronics and Systems Engineering: Top English-taught Study Programs in Germany (2026/2027)

Studying Mechatronic Systems Engineering as an international student prepares you to design and integrate intelligent machines that combine mechanics, electronics, software, and control systems into fully functional systems. The program covers mechatronics, robotics, embedded systems, sensor technology, automation, modeling and simulation, and industrial communication networks, with a strong emphasis on hands-on laboratory work and real-world engineering projects. Germany and other leading engineering destinations offer state-of-the-art facilities and close collaboration with automotive, robotics, and automation industries.
